Anisotropic Two-Microlocal Spaces and Regularity
We define D-u-anisotropic two-microlocal spaces by decay conditions on anisotropic wavelet coefficients on any D-u-anisotropic wavelet basis of L2(Rd). We prove that these spaces allow the characterizing of pointwise anisotropic Hölder regularity.

Global Schauder estimates for kinetic Kolmogorov-Fokker-Planck equations
We present global Schauder type estimates in all variables and unique solvability results in kinetic Hölder spaces for kinetic Kolmogorov-Fokker-Planck (KFP) equations.

The aproximation of functions in generalized Holder spaces [PDF]
The theorems of approximation of complex functions determined on the closed arbitrary contour Г of the complex plane by means of Lagrange interpolating polynomials in generalized Holder spaces Hw were obtained.
